Met up with 27 other AngleMoggers and 8 Morgans at Layer Marney in Essex, an old Tudor part finished mansion. Not only did we get a private tour but also saw a display of birds of prey and a cream tea.

I also tried out for the first time as Centre Sec the AngleMog flag which Roger Bull handed over to me in November. I had been told it was big and I think it fits that description.

My thanks to Christine & Roger for the organisation

Surprisingly good turn out with wide range of Classic cars at the small village of Tostock in Suffolk. Run by local pub The Gardener's with cars parked on the adjacent sprawling village green.

No contest for oldest vehicle there.

[Linked Image]

Despite large audience it started first turn of the handle with help from compression reduction valve.

Straight out of Downton.

[Linked Image]

Loved this tiny engined 1931 MG Midget J2

[Linked Image]

35 mile round trip and despite numbers no problem getting a full evening meal although the usual car show fayre was on offer as well.

Run up to Beamish for the Mog event. Departed at 7.30 and we were amazed to find the A1 so clear. Under two hours to get there and about 115 miles.

Left just before 3.30, and surprise surprise, the A1 was free running and not busy. After the M1 split it got really deserted because it was blocked between J35 and 34. We get off at 37, before the blockage heading South, so we've never had such good A1 experiences before on a summer Saturday'

The Mog Event was well attended. Beamish is well worth a visit although the main town was heaving. A great day out.
